Just before the fight between Rasque and Alix started, Eric took it upon himself to began the assignment like his fellow students. Not that he felt embarrassed that the girl he call mama was picking a fight with a teacher. He called Alix "Mama Wolf" in public after all, something this small could never bother him.

He was honestly just interested to see how other weapons preformed with his Runic magic. For the past few months, he and Alix had been trying to find out how to use his magic appropriately. They managed to discover that it was possible just difficult in the beginning.

It took a bit but Eric did eventually get the hang of activating the Rune just not for very long. Now all that was left was figuring out how to battle with it, and what better time to practice than during an assignment where the point was finding the weapon he felt most comfortable with.

Eric liked his Ritual Knife a whole lot so he couldn't see himself changing to a spear or bow but there was always a chance like the teacher had said. Eric walked over to the pile of weapons.

Several of them had already been taken with more swords being gone than anything. Makes sense seeing as most knight families wielded swords and all. Eric decided to choose the axe as his first trial weapon and began to scan the wall for an opponent.

As he looked he realized that all of the seniors were already in battle with a queue students waiting their turns. 'I really don't want to have to wait.' It was then that Eric noticed a person leaning against the wall in the shadows of a corner all to themself.

The person noticed Eric staring and waved with Eric waving back. The person pointed at the axe in Eric's hand and then to himself. Eric was a unsure what the student wanted but decided to walk over to him.

"So you came?" Weird opening line for someone that clearly wanted somebody to talk to them.

"Did you also want an axe?" Eric asked the man while presenting the axe to him. The boy shook his head.

"Nah, I don't use axes. Always been more of a big sword guy, ya know?"

"Why would I know that? I just met you?" The boy chuckled amused.

"That's true. I'm Nasak, does that axe feel good in your hand?" Nasak gestured to the axe with his head. Eric tried swinging it a few times before shaking his head.

"Nah, the balance feels all weird. Besides, I don't think I can really make someone bleed with this thing."

"Of course you can, it's an axe. Besides, I'm pretty sure most weapons can make a person bleed." Eric shook his head.

"You just don't get it. When I cut someone with my knife the amount of blood that comes out with each cut..." Eric smiled wondrously to himself while imagining the blood pouring out of each cut made by his knife.

"...it's so beautiful." Eric realized that his bloodlust was starting to show and immediately calmed down. He returned his gaze to Nasak who was reasonably shocked.

But not frightened.

"...Interesting. Why don't we see then?" Nasak pushed himself off of the wall and walked into the light allowing Eric to see his features more clearly.

Nasak had brown hair and deep maroon eyes. He was rather muscular for a person around Eric's age making the boy feel a bit self-conscious. It did help that Eric was taller than Nasak who seemed likely shorter than even Alix by about two inches.

Nasak was wearing a tattered white shirt, old worn slacks, and a dirty tan cloak.

Wait, tan cloak?

"Are you a member of F-class?" Nasak nodded.

"Yeah, we prefer the Fantastical Fools. And by we I mean our leader, Alisa. Put that axe on the ground over there." Eric did as he was instructed.

"Now show me that knife you were braggin' so much about." Eric unsheathed his knife with no hesitation. It was starting to seem like he was far too accustomed to taking orders from people.

Nasak inspected the knife closely grunting whenever he noticed something that interested him. "Where did you find this thing? It's craftsmanship is amazing."

"I found it in a cave." Eric spoke vaguely a detail that Nasak noticed but did not question.

"Cool, it's a real work of art. Let's give it a try." Nasak presented his arm to Eric. Eric was confused as to why this person was showing him his arm. Was he trying to show off his biceps?

"Your muscles are cool and all but why are you showing me your arm?"

"Cut it with your knife." Nasak pointed at Eric's knife.

"Why?"

"You said that it makes people bleed a lot. I want to see just how much." Eric was starting to think that this person was very weird. On the other hand, he hadn't gotten the chance to cut anyone to absorb blood for a few days now and he could feel a frenzy coming in his future.

"Alright!" Eric swiftly swung the knife many times tearing into Nasak's arm. Each cut raising Eric's anticipation more and more. He had to see the blood. He needed to feel it on his arm. On his stomach! He needed to get that sweet euphoric feeling of ripping through flesh!

Actually, he should have gotten that feeling already. Why does he not feel any flesh tearing?" Eric looked at Nasak's arm and realized that though he had swung many times he only left several shallow cuts on the boy.

"Wooow. That was disappointing." Nasak yawned. "You really shouldn't be using that knife you know. You clearly don't know how to use it and I think it's way too old for it to be useful. I doubt you even tried to sharpen it."

Eric's eyes sat wide on his face. This was the first time that he had ever been incapable of inflicting someone with a grievous wound.

"Is your arm made of metal or something? Why can't I cut?" Eric was now holding Nasak's arm in place while jamming the knife into his skin. It was, once again, barely working!

"You've never seen anyone use Lis like this before? Are you sure, you're a Martial student? This is beginner stuff."

"I'm actually technically a spellcaster." Nasak frowned.

"But you use a knife?" Eric shrugged.

"So I'm a spellcaster that wields a weapon. It isn't that uncommon, I mean look at paladins." Nasak's eyes widened for a moment before he burst into laughter.

"Dude, holy arts and magic are two different things!

Eric stood dumbfounded. "They are?" Nasak nodded still laughing.

"Hey, want to try to use one of my swords?"

"You have swords?" Nasak scoffed as Eric released his arm. 

"Do I have swords? I'll let you try-"

BOOOOM!!!

At that moment, Rasque Bizen crashed into the wall next to Eric and Nasak with the force of a bolt of lightning. The sight was shocking to say the least but Eric realized that the instructor had fought Alix so this was rather expected honestly.

"What were yo-" Eric tried to continued his conversation but Nasak had completely disappeared. No, he hadn't disappeared. He just moved across the room, threw his cloak back on, and started sweeping the ground around the instructor.

"Been workin' this entire time ma'am! No need to report me to the warden!" Nasak noticed Eric staring at him and bowed apologetically. He then cupped his handed whispered something to Eric.

"Join the sword class, we can talk more in there."
